EIA-485(過去叫做RS-485或者RS485)是隸屬于OSI模型物理層的電氣特性規(guī)定為2線、半雙工、平衡傳輸線多點通信的標準。
是由電信行業(yè)協(xié)會(TIA)及電子工業(yè)聯(lián)盟(EIA)聯(lián)合發(fā)布的標準。
實現(xiàn)此標準的數(shù)字通信網(wǎng)可以在有電子噪聲的環(huán)境下進行長距離有效率的通信。
在線性多點總線的配置下,可以在一個網(wǎng)絡(luò)上有多個接收器。
因此適用在工業(yè)環(huán)境中。
EIA-485(過去叫做RS-485或者RS485)是隸屬于OSI模型物理層的電氣特性規(guī)定為2線、半雙工、平衡傳輸線多點通信的標準。
是由電信行業(yè)協(xié)會(TIA)及電子工業(yè)聯(lián)盟(EIA)聯(lián)合發(fā)布的標準。
實現(xiàn)此標準的數(shù)字通信網(wǎng)可以在有電子噪聲的環(huán)境下進行長距離有效率的通信。
在線性多點總線的配置下,可以在一個網(wǎng)絡(luò)上有多個接收器。
因此適用在工業(yè)環(huán)境中。
EIA一開始將RS(Recommended Standard)做為標準的前綴,不過后來為了便于識別標準的來源,已將RS改為EIA/TIA。
電子工業(yè)聯(lián)盟(EIA)已結(jié)束運作,此標準目前是電信行業(yè)協(xié)會(TIA)維護,名稱為TIA-485,但工程師及應(yīng)用指南仍繼續(xù)用RS-485來稱呼此一協(xié)議。
EIA-485的電氣特性和RS-232不大一樣。
用纜線兩端的電壓差值來表示傳遞信號,不同的電壓差分別標識為邏輯1及邏輯0。
兩端的電壓差最小為0.2V以上時有效,任何不大于12V或者不小于-7V的差值對接受端都被認為是正確的。
EIA-485僅僅規(guī)定了接受端和發(fā)送端的電氣特性。
它沒有規(guī)定或推薦任何數(shù)據(jù)協(xié)議。
EIA-485可以應(yīng)用于配置便宜的區(qū)域網(wǎng)和采用單機發(fā)送,多機接受通信鏈接,使用和EIA-422類似的差動雙絞線。
它提供高速的數(shù)據(jù)通信速率(10m時35Mbit/s;1200m時100kbit/s)。
有一個有關(guān)EIA-485的經(jīng)驗法則,是比特率乘以線長(單位為米)的乘積無法超過10,因此50 m的在線速度不會超過2 Mbit/s,在特定條件下,其數(shù)據(jù)通信速率可以到64Mbit/s.。
EIA-485和EIA-422一樣使用雙絞線進行高電壓差分平衡傳輸,它可以進行大面積長距離傳輸(超過4000英尺,1200米)。
和EIA-422相對照的是,EIA-422采用不可轉(zhuǎn)換的單發(fā)送端,EIA-485的發(fā)送端需要設(shè)置為發(fā)送模式,這使得EIA-485可以使用雙線模式實現(xiàn)真正的多點雙向通信。
EIA-485推薦使用在點對點網(wǎng)絡(luò)中,線型、總線型,不能是星型、環(huán)型網(wǎng)絡(luò)。
假如必須要使用星型網(wǎng)絡(luò),可以配合特殊的RS-485 star/hub中繼器,可以在多個網(wǎng)絡(luò)中雙向的監(jiān)聽數(shù)據(jù),并且將數(shù)據(jù)再發(fā)送到其他的網(wǎng)絡(luò)上。
理想情況下EIA-485需要2個終接電阻,其阻值要求等于傳輸電纜的特性阻抗(一般而言,雙絞線會是120ohms)。
沒有特性阻抗的話,當所有的設(shè)備都靜止或者沒有能量的時候就會產(chǎn)生噪聲,而且線移需要雙端的電壓差。
沒有終接電阻的話,會使得較快速的發(fā)送端產(chǎn)生多個數(shù)據(jù)信號的邊緣,這其中的一些是不正確的。
之所以不能使用星型或者環(huán)型的拓撲結(jié)構(gòu)是由于這些結(jié)構(gòu)有不必要的反映,過低或者過高的終接電阻可以產(chǎn)生電磁干擾(EMI)。
有時在一組網(wǎng)絡(luò)在線。
會加上上拉及接地電阻(偏置電阻),若通信在線沒有任何設(shè)備時,上面的數(shù)據(jù)可以有失效安全的機制。
這樣可以讓網(wǎng)絡(luò)在線有固定的偏置電壓,節(jié)點較不容易在沒有任何節(jié)點發(fā)送數(shù)據(jù)時,將在線的噪聲解讀成實際的數(shù)據(jù)。
若沒有偏置電阻,通信線處于浮接的狀態(tài),在所有節(jié)點都未發(fā)送數(shù)據(jù)或未供電時,最容易受到噪聲的影響。